The box is classic, & the first thing you notice is that patent leather… it "really" pops under the lights. For a low-top, the silhouette is instantly recognizable & the build quality feels solid. At around $200, it's a premium price for a premium-looking shoe. My initial thought? It's a clean, summer-ready version of an icon. Let's talk about this specific 'Legend Blue' colorway. In hand, the icy blue outsole is stunning, but be warned: it "will" yellow. That’s just the nature of the material. The white nubuck upper is premium but a magnet for dirt. So, as a daily beater? Maybe not. But for a clean, summer sneaker rotation, this "AJ11 Low" is a top contender. Is it worth the price? For me, "yes" - but with a caveat. At its core, the Air Jordan 11 Low is a lifestyle shoe. You’re paying for the heritage, the design, and the flex. Don’t expect cutting-edge performance tech. If you want a comfy, head-turning shoe from the Jordan series, it’s a great pick. Slipping these on… the fit is "true to size" for me. The "air jordan 11 low" has a snug, secure feel—especially in the midfoot. Now, the cushioning? It's not super plush or bouncy like some modern shoes. That full-length Air unit is more about stable comfort. If you want a pillowy feel, this might not be for you. But for all-day wear? It's perfect.
